POSITION SUMMARY:

ITW Specialty Films, a division of Illinois Tool Works (ITW), manufactures coated and metalized films for the Financial Card, Secure ID, Specialty Medical Bag, Holographic, and Lamination markets. Operating from 8 locations across North America and Europe, the division leverages unique core competencies and deep technical expertise to meet specialized customer needs.

We are seeking a site Controller for our manufacturing site in Cranbury, NJ. The controller serves as a strategic business partner and is critical to the success of the facility. This role is vital to financial reporting, internal controls, operational budget and cost insight, and talent pipeline development.  The Controller manages a team of one and plays a leadership role in developing cross-functional trust and collaboration, and acts as an advisor to the Operations Manager. This position will be based at the Cranbury, NJ location, and will report directly to the Division Controller. 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ITES:

Financial Planning & Reporting

Coordinate and direct the financial planning, budgeting, and reporting for the organization.  Prepare or direct preparation of financial statements, business reports, annual budgets and/or reports required by corporate and/or regulatory agencies.Ensure an accurate and timely monthly, quarterly and year end close in strict accordance with ITW Financial reporting policies (USGAAP).Effectively communicate and coordinate the exchange of financial information to key stakeholders (global finance team and local leadership team).Advise management team on short-term and long-term financial objectives, policies, and actions; prepare ad-hoc analyses for local and Division management for use in decision making.Support Division leadership team to achieve division goals and objectives.Manage annual budgeting and forecasting processes along with monthly outlook updates for US units.

Financial Records, Systems, Processes & Internal Controls

Manage compliance to accounting policies and procedures to ensure accurate and timely financial statements.Direct and manage Inventory, including a full understanding of the BOM’s and Product Costing, along with the labor & overhead standards update, A/P, A/R, Banking Activities (ACH, Positive Pay, Bank reconciliations), Corporate Credit Cards, Fixed Asset, Payroll, and other administrative activities as assigned.Understand and apply ITW financial policies consistently and effectively. Ensures that accurate financial records and strong internal controls are in place and being followed.Document and monitor internal controls. Ensures that transactions are recorded in an efficient and timely manner.Coordinate internal and external audits as well as other corporate requests.

Financial Analysis / Continuous Improvement

Analyze the financial details of past, present, and expected operations to identify development opportunities and areas where improvement is needed. Perform analytical reviews of data and explain variances against plan, outlook, and prior year.Monitor and analyze department work to develop more efficient procedures and use of resources while maintaining a high level of accuracy. Apply the ITW Principles to eliminate complexity and improve profitability of the company. Participate in teams and play a lead role in the collection and analysis of data for these projects.

Team Management & Development

Lead and coach one direct report with focus on development planning to maximize performance and increase bench strength and capabilitiesFosters a culture of engagement, learning and accountabilityProvide mentorship to emerging leaders within the site teamUse change management skills to effectively plan, implement, and evaluate change.

SKILLS & QUALIFICATIONS:

Bachelor’s degree in accounting/finance required.  MBA preferred.5+ years of progressive accounting experience including general and cost accounting with responsibility for Inventory Control, P&L Management, and Balance Sheet Management required; significant and relevant experience in a manufacturing environment strongly preferredAdept at creating budgets from the ground up and effectively managing to the established budget.Proven track record of effectively partnering with cross-functional team members at all levels, translating data into useful information about the business, and influencing strategic initiatives to drive operational/financial results.An ability to generate respect and trust, while leading through influenceExcellent time and project management skills, strong attention to detail, prioritization abilities with streamlining/simplification mindset, and strong project management skills.Effective cross-functional communicator and collaborator

WORK ENVIRONMENT & PHYSICAL DEMANDS:

Work is normally performed in an office environment; requires frequent sitting, computer use, and communication with both office and production floor teamsNeed to enter production areas; proper PPE required and provided as needed.Travel requirements – Up to 5% to our NA facilities
